THE EDITOR, Madam:

I wish to commend Senator Abka Fitz-Henley on a most thoughtful and hard-hitting opening of the State of the Nation Debate in the Senate.

Fitz-Henley was courageous in outlining tangible actions taken in the interest of the advancement of the Jamaican people and calling out the former PNP administration for missteps which have set Jamaica back badly.

It’s clear this young man is aware of his political history, and the actions required to move Jamaica forward.

Senator Fitz-Henley was right when he said never again should Jamaica pursue policies similar to those which occurred under the former PNP administration that caused a raft of businesses to collapse and thousands of people to lose their savings.

I do not expect everybody to be happy at Senator Fitz-Henley’s presentation, but that’s because, as he rightfully quipped in the Senate, the truth hurts. Fitz-Henley’s maiden presentation in the Parliament was a great one which offered much food for thought.

JEAN CLARKE
